Polish Football Association has announced a slate of new licensing partners.

The latest deals for the federation include a version of Monopoly based on the team, a Kapsle football game and Soccerstarz figures. All of these deals were released within the last month.

The collection of products with the PZPN family trademarks and images of the Polish national team players has been developing since 2013.

The new deals add to the PZPN portfolio of nearly 500 products, one online and two stationary shops. The federation is continuing to search for and find licensing deals.
